Barry Corbin

Barry Corbin is a popular American actor who was born as Leonard Barrie Corbin on October 16th of 1940. Corbin was born to Kilmer Blaine Corbin Sr. and LaMerle Scott.

He is from Lamesa, Texas, and pursued his high school education from ‘Monterey High School.’

Barry went on to do his college at the Texas Tech University but he ended up taking a break to join the US Marine Corps. However, he came back after 2 years and completed his degree at the university.

Movies & TV Shows

Corbin is widely known for his role in the famous television series titled ‘Northern Exposure’ from 1990 to 1995. He played the character of Maurice Minnifield on the show.

The show helped him bag 2 nominations for the Primetime Emmy Award consecutively. Some of his other notable hits include:

  • Urban Cowboy – 1980
  • Lonesome Dove – 1989
  • Yellowstone – 2021
  • Stir Crazy – 1980
  • The Ranch – 2016 to 2020
  • WarGames – 1983
  • The Closer – 2007 to 2012
  • No Country for Old Men – 2007
  • One Tree Hill – 2003 to 2009, and
  • Dallas – 1979 to 1984

Personal Life & Data

Barry measures up to 1.8m and weighs about 160 pounds. He has dark brown eyes and black hair that captivates our eyes.

Corbin has been married thrice and divorced twice. His first spouse was Marie Elyse Soape from 1965 to 1974.

His second wife was Susan Berger from 1976 to 1992. And finally, he married his current wife Jo Corbin in 2016.

The actor has 4 children: 3 sons and 1 daughter. They are Bernard, Jim, Christopher, and Shannon. Barry adopted his daughter, whose birth mother had a relationship with him in the past during his college days.

Barry currently has an impressive net worth of $4 Million. This money comes from his successful and long-lasting career in Hollywood.

Most people aren’t aware of this, but Corbin has also appeared in video games and played in many theatres. All of these pursuits have contributed to his current wealth today.

He was inducted into the famous ‘Texas Cowboy Hall of Fame’ in 2009 back in Fort Worth, Texas. Corbin was also awarded a ‘Lifetime Achievement Award’ at the Estes Park Film Festival back in 2011.
